On 27 January 2026, the first regional workshop on the dissemination of results of the joint project of the Executive Committee of the International Fund for Saving the Aral Sea (EC IFAS) and Agence Française de Développement (AFD) was held in Shymkent, Kazakhstan. The project, entitled “Correction of hydromodule zoning of the Syrdarya river basin using remote sensing data and satellite mapping technologies for correction of water consumption and irrigation regimes for agricultural crops cultivated in the region” (the Project), was presented to a wide range of stakeholders.
